Annotation -
Last update: Šídlová Martina Ing. Ph.D. (26.01.2018)
The course is focused on the classification, processing and recycling of inorganic, especially silicate wastes. The first part of this course is focused on waste treatment methods in general. The principles of machinery used in waste treatment and recycling are discussed. Further, the basics of waste management legislation are discussed. The main part of the course deals with wastes in the production of inorganic binders, building materials and in glass and ceramics industry.

Syllabus -
Last update: Šídlová Martina Ing. Ph.D. (14.02.2018)

1. Information sources, legislation and classification of waste materials

2. Treatment of waste materials

3. Treatment of waste materials – burning, alternative fuels

4. Treatment of waste materials - deposits

5. Wastes from energy and metallurgy – slag, fly ash, fumes

6. Basics of Portland cement technology

7. Basics of concrete technology

8. Waste utilization at building materials production

9. Binders and building materials on the waste CaSO4 basis

10. Construction and demolition waste and its recycling

11. Basics of glass technology, recycling of glass

12. Basics of technology of ceramics, recycling of ceramics

13. Radioactive waste
